Sony has commenced its push out of the Android 6.0 Marshmallow update to some of its Sony Xperia range of devices for users on Canada carriers. The over the air update which should have reached a couple of users by now, is headed out to Xperia Z2, Xperia Z3 and Xperia Z3 Compact.The Marshmallow update which already landed to the aforementioned Xperia handsets in India, will come coupled with the popular Android 6.0 features and functionalities with the inclusion of Doze battery saving mode, granular app permission controls and Google Now on Tap. Furthermore, Sony has stated that the update will bundle a few improvements such as:
  • An all new camera UI, which will allow you to smoothly navigate through modes as well as incorporate customization using gestures.
  • Newly added creative stickers to the Xperia Messenger.
  • Direct Share feature for sharing activities, apps and contacts with friends.

What's my model number?

There are several ways to locate your model number:

Option 1
On your device, go to Settings, then "About device" and scroll down to "Model number"
Option 2
Often times you can view the model number inside the device, by removing the battery
Option 3
Using Samsung's model/serial number location tool
